Protein structure modeling for structural genomics

Nat Struct Biol. 2000 Nov:7 Suppl:986-90. doi: 10.1038/80776.

Abstract

The shapes of most protein sequences will be modeled based on their similarity to experimentally determined protein structures. The current role, limitations, challenges and prospects for protein structure modeling (using information about genes and genomes) are discussed in the context of structural genomics.
